Output 3f609d7278324ffbd2f5692b9fa05a720032537b89c1926201c1cf5c54520f75:1

value
41186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6c950c94943db61599a8a5a493c9e01ba0b8e4e97755ddae0311b710c9ea34db
address
bc1pdj2se9y58kmptxdg5kjf8j0qrwst3e8fwa2amtsrzxm3pj02xndsu4w5yd
transaction
3f609d7278324ffbd2f5692b9fa05a720032537b89c1926201c1cf5c54520f75
confirmations
171068
spent
true